ARCHETYPE Segmentation information entity (openEHR-EHR-CLUSTER.segmentation_information_entity.v0)

ARCHETYPE IDopenEHR-EHR-CLUSTER.segmentation_information_entity.v0
ConceptSegmentation information entity
DescriptionA segmentation is the extraction of a region of interest from a radiological image. The representation of a segmentation with this archetype contains information about the segmentation itself (name and date and time of creation). Furthermore, references to the image used and the segmented mask in DICOM. Segmentation Property Type and Segmentation Property Category and optionally their modification with Segmented Propety Type Modifier are used to represent properties of a segmentation.
UseUse to extend the openEHR-EHR-CLUSTER.imaging_finding.v0 archetpye in the "Structured detail" slot.
PurposeTo record information about a segmentation of a radiological image.
